Airs Monday, October 10, 2011, 8:00p.m. ET/PT. Check your local listings
Items related to Martin Luther King Jr.'s 1966 visit to St. Mark's AME Zion Church in Durham; a circa 1800 Virginia-made table with purported ties to Thomas Jefferson; and a pair of circa 1725 chairs by furniture maker John Gaines. 10/10/2011
